What is Double Glazing?
Before exploring leak repairs, it's vital to understand what double glazing is. Double glazing includes 2 glass panes separated by a space filled with argon gas or vacuum, producing insulation. This design reduces heat transfer, sound penetration, and condensation.

Recognizing leaks early can save homeowners from expensive repairs and pain. Here are typical signs that indicate a double glazing leak:

Condensation Between Panes: This is often the most significant indication. If condensation happens in between the Glass Condensation Repair panes, it implies the seal has actually failed.

Drafts: A visible breeze near windows is a clear indicator that air is leaving.

Increased Energy Bills: Homeowners might see a spike in heating or cooling expenses due to loss of insulation.

Water Damage: Puddles near windows or moisture on walls might suggest leaks.
Causes of Double Glazing Leaks
Comprehending the causes of leakages is essential for reliable repairs. Typical causes include:

Seal Failure: Over time, the seals that keep the glass panes airtight can deteriorate due to age, temperature level fluctuations, and ecological aspects.

Inappropriate Installation: If the double glazing was not installed properly, it could cause immediate leaks.

Impact Damage: Accidental effects from items can split or break seals.

Poor Maintenance: Neglecting routine checks can result in undetected problems, causing leaks.

Frequently asked questions1. How do I know if my double glazing needs repairing?
Look for signs of condensation between the panes, noticeable water damage, or drafts near the Misted Windows. A boost in energy costs can also show a problem.
2. Can I fix double glazing myself?
Small concerns can in some cases be resolved with DIY Repair Double Glazing Units packages, however for significant problems, especially seal replacement or system replacement, professional assistance is suggested.
3. The length of time does double glazing last?
Double glazing units can last 20 years or more with correct care and upkeep, but different factors can impact their durability.
4. Is it worth repairing double glazing?
Yes, repairing Double Glazing Moisture glazing can save expenses on energy bills and boost the comfort of your home. Oftentimes, repairs are more cost-efficient than complete replacements.
5. What is the cost of double glazing leak repair?
Costs can vary extensively based on the extent of the damage and the repair technique selected. Usually, minor repairs may vary from ₤ 100 to ₤ 300, while complete system replacements might cost upwards of ₤ 600 or more.
